Who: Los Samaritanos de Tucson and individuals that attempt to cross the southern Arizona border, and those for/against Los Samaritanos.
What: Los Samaritanos de Tucson are taking donations of water, clothes, shoes, hygiene, and non-perishable food for individuals that attempt to cross the southern Arizona border.
When: 2016
Why: Protesters will be showing support or disapproval for the "What" of Los Sumaritanos. Argument for: it is a humanistic approach to immigration, argument against: it is supporting undocumented immigration into the United States.
Identity: Two identities of this protest is "immigrant" and "samaritan."
Protest Strategy: Have Los Samaritanos de Tucson at their donation collection center and have the against party protesting the center drop off. Regardless of protest, Los Sumaritanos deliver the materials along the border for the individuals attempting to cross the border.
Protest Slogan: "A healing presence along the border."
Ethical? Yes, humanistic approach to immigration.
Legal? Yes because of laws like DACA and DAPA.
Effective? How? Yes because protesters are able to save lives and be in good standing with the law.
Ethos: Number of helpers that were past border control or law enforcement.
Pathos: Number of people that die during this journey because they it is the desert.
Logos: Placing materials throughout the desert for easy access to all individuals.
